How a Montevideo Converter Cut Consumables TCO by 28% in 8 Months: A Detailed Case Study

When this Montevideo-based flexible packaging converter agreed to trial INDIGO Electroink consumables across all four fluid categories, they expected cost savings. What they did not expect was that print quality would improve while monthly consumables spend dropped by more than a quarter.

The converter — a well-established flexible packaging specialist serving the Uruguayan food export sector — runs a single Hp Indigo 25k press producing approximately 10 million impressions per year. Their substrate mix is roughly 50 percent BOPP film, 30 percent PET, and 20 percent coated paper. Before the switch, they purchased OEM primer for film substrates (due to adhesion concerns) and used a mix of OEM and generic alternatives for imaging oil, recycle agent, and conductive agent.

The result was predictable: adhesive failures on BOPP jobs, inconsistent density on long runs, and imaging oil changes every 300,000 impressions. The converter’s technical team suspected that consumable quality was the root cause, but the production manager was hesitant to switch entirely to compatible consumables — until INDIGO Electroink proposed a phased trial with a performance guarantee.

Phase 1: Primer and Imaging Oil (Months 1–2)

The trial began with the two highest-volume consumables: BOPP primer (PS-310) and imaging oil. The converter continued using OEM recycle agent and conductive agent during this phase, to isolate the effect of the primer and oil change.

Results were visible within the first month. The BOPP-specific primer eliminated the intermittent adhesion failures that had been occurring on food packaging runs — particularly those destined for refrigerated storage. The imaging oil showed equivalent density consistency to the OEM product, with no increase in consumption rate. Based on these results, the converter approved Phase 2.

“The BOPP primer was the breakthrough. We had been living with a 1.5 to 2 percent failure rate on refrigerator-grade labels. After switching to the INDIGO Electroink BOPP primer, that dropped to zero. In Month 3, the converter switched completely to the INDIGO Electroink four-fluid system: PS-310 BOPP primer, imaging oil, recycle agent, and conductive agent. This was the moment of truth for TCO measurement — with all four fluids from a single compatible manufacturer, would the system-level compatibility deliver the promised savings?

The answer was yes, across multiple metrics:

Metric Before (Mixed OEM/Generic) After (INDIGO Electroink) Change
Imaging oil change interval ~300K impressions ~720K impressions +140%
Substrate waste rate 2.1% 0.9% -57%
Consumables-related downtime (hrs/mo) 10.5 1.2 -89%
Monthly consumables spend (indexed) 100% 72% -28%
Total Cost of Ownership Baseline -28% Best-in-class

The Recycle Agent Impact

The single largest contributor to TCO reduction was the recycle agent. With the INDIGO Electroink formulation, imaging oil change intervals extended from approximately 300,000 impressions to over 700,000 — more than doubling oil life. Over an 8-month period, the converter purchased 52 percent less imaging oil than the same period the previous year, while maintaining identical print quality metrics.

The recycle agent itself costs less per liter than imaging oil, so the payback period for switching to a high-performance formulation is measured in weeks, not months. For this converter, the recycle agent upgrade paid for itself in approximately 21 days.

Quality Outcomes: Meeting Export Specifications

The converter’s customers include Uruguayan food exporters whose products must survive refrigerated shipping to Brazil, Argentina, and Europe. Label adhesion under refrigeration is a make-or-break specification. Before the primer switch, approximately 1.5 to 2 percent of BOPP labels failed the refrigerator adhesion test. After the switch, that failure rate dropped to zero — not once, but sustained across every production run for 8 months.

Color consistency also improved. With the matched four-fluid system, solid density variation across a 50,000-impression run decreased from ±0.08 delta-E to ±0.04 delta-E. For the converter’s customers — who maintain brand color standards across product lines — this improvement was immediately visible and commercially valuable.
